Authorized User accounts. If you purchase rights of use in website community management SaaS Services which are designed to enable collaborative learning and social networking within a school district, your right to use these SaaS Services shall be limited by a specified number of Authorized User accounts. The “Authorized User account” limitation shall be specified in the applicable Order form and you shall not be permitted to allow use of the SaaS Services to anyone other than those individual account holders who are specified by name on a list maintained by you, where the total account holders shall not exceed the specified limitation.

Authorized User accounts. Authorized Users can choose what email address to use when they create an account for the Cloud Service. However, if the email domain associated with any Authorized User’s account is owned or controlled by You and You then add their account to Your subscription, their account and Personal Data will be associated with You, following notice from Cisco. Authorized Users may change the email associated with their account by following these instructions. If they do nothing, their account and Personal Data will be controlled by You and their use will be subject to Yourpolicies.
Authorized User accounts. In order to use the Products, each Authorized User will need to create an account through the Products and accept the Headspace Terms & Conditions located at xxxxx://xxx.xxxxxxxxx.xxx/terms-and-conditions (the “Authorized User Terms & Conditions”). Such Authorized User Terms & Conditions may be modified by Headspace from time to time with or without notice. Any Authorized User violating the Authorized User Terms & Conditions may have the Authorized User’s account and access to the Products suspended or terminated as provided therein.

Authorized User accounts. In order to access the Headspace Content, each Authorized User will create an account and accept the Headspace Terms & Conditions located at xxxxx://xxx.xxxxxxxxx.xxx/terms-and-conditions (the “Authorized User Terms & Conditions”). If at any time, an Authorized User leaves Customer’s employment, or is no longer engaged as a contractor by Xxxxxxxx, such Authorized User may transition its account to an individual account with Headspace without losing access to Headspace Content or saved usage history. Such Authorized User Terms & Conditions may be modified by Headspace from time to time with or without notice. Any Authorized User violating the Authorized User Terms & Conditions may have the Authorized User’s account and access to the Headspace Content suspended or terminated as provided therein.

Authorized User accounts. Palantir will provide Customer with the capability to provision and establish accounts to access the Products (“Accounts”) for Customer’s employees or independent contractors with a need to access the Products on behalf of Customer for its internal purposes (“Authorized Users”), on the condition that Customer has confidentiality obligations in place for each Authorized User at least as restrictive as those stated herein and, upon request by Palantir, provides Palantir with company names of any independent contractors who have access to the Products.
Authorized User accounts. To use the Service, you must be an individual person and you must create a unique account. In creating an account, you agree to provide a unique email address to serve as your username; select a user password; provide accurate, current and complete information as may be prompted by any registration forms on the Service; and maintain and promptly update such data and any other information provided to TBFS, to keep it accurate, current and complete. If a Client provided you with your account (e.g., you are an employee or contractor for that Client), you understand that this Client has rights to your account and may (a) manage your account (including suspending or cancelling it); (b) reset your password; (c) view your usage data including how and when your account is used; and (d) view and manage the content you enter into the Service using your account. TBFS may act on the Client’s behalf as requested in this regard. You understand and acknowledge that use of a single Authorized User account by multiple people is prohibited. You are only entitled to receive the features and functionality the Client who provided you with access has purchased either via its Subscription or any products, services, features, and functionality which is not included in a given Subscription but which may be purchased from TBFS separately (“Add Ons”). Except as otherwise required by applicable law, you are responsible for all activity that occurs on your account, whether or not authorized by you, and it is your responsibility to maintain the confidentiality of your password and any other account credentials. You must notify us immediately of any unauthorized use (or suspicion of unauthorized use) of your password or your account, or any other breach of security related to your use of the Service. TBFS will not be liable for losses caused by any unauthorized use of your account, however you may be liable for the losses, damages, liabilities, expenses, and fees incurred by us or a third-party arising from someone else using your account, regardless of whether you have notified us of such unauthorized use.
